Job description

Geospatial Analyst II Agency

Texas A&M Forest Service Department Enterprise Data & Analytics

Proposed Minimum Salary$6,037.50 monthly

Job LocationCollege Station, Texas

Job TypeStaff

Join Us in the Fight Against Wildfires Wildfires are becoming more frequent and intense, threatening lives, property, and natural resources in Texas. We need forward-looking problem solvers to help Texas A&M Forest Service (TAMFS) and the citizens of Texas stay ahead of the threat. As part of our integrated technology team in the Applied Technology Department of the Fire and Emergency Response (FERM) Division, you’ll have the opportunity to develop data-driven solutions, automate critical workflows, and deliver timely products to enhance wildfire preparedness and response. If you're passionate about using technology to combat wildfires and want to make a tangible impact, we want to hear from you.

Why This Role Matters

In this position, you’ll play a crucial role in advancing geospatial and data technologies that improve situational awareness, optimize emergency response, and drive smarter decision-making. From conducting complex geospatial analyses to streamlining data flows, your expertise will help firefighters and emergency managers protect communities and ecosystems across the state.

What You’ll Do
  • -Develop and enhance data-driven solutions that improve wildfire response and resource management.
  • -Conduct advanced geospatial analyses to address complex wildfire and natural resource challenges.
  • -Automate workflows to maximize efficiency and improve response times.
  • -Communicate insights effectively through reports, visualizations, and interactive platforms.
  • -Compile, process, and manage complex tabular, vector, and raster data sources in support of analyses and applications.
  • -Support collaboration and program messaging within FERM ]through application of latest technology.
  • -Participate in agency’s geospatial working group, professional development, and collaborate with other agency programs in TAMFS.
  • -Occasionally support emergency response operations as requested, which may include working extended hours and weekends.
Required qualifications:
  • -Bachelor’s degree in forestry, natural resources, spatial sciences, math, statistics, or related field of study.
  • -Minimum of 4 years in geospatial analysis, statistical analysis, or similar, in either an academic or professional setting. An advanced degree may substitute for experience.
  • -Strong working knowledge of concepts and processes of data analysis including creating, organizing, manipulating, maintaining, analyzing, and visualizing data.
  • -Analytical skills in at least one of the following areas: environmental geospatial modeling, remote sensing, and/or spatial statistics.
  • -Ability to work independently and use sound judgment to find solutions to common, complex problems.
  • -Ability to manage projects effectively.
  • -Ability and desire to keep abreast of new developments and standards in geospatial technology and analysis.
  • -Proficient in MS Office, ArcGIS Pro, Python, and remote sensing software.
  • -Working knowledge of relational database concepts.
  • -Demonstrated problem solving and critical thinking skills.
  • -Ability to communicate work to both technical and non-technical audiences, with effective oral, written, and visual modes of communication.
  • -Ability to work effectively as part of a team.
Preferred qualifications:
  • -Graduate degree in forestry, natural resources, spatial sciences, math, statistics, or related field of study.
  • -Experience with or interest in natural resources, especially with emphasis in forestry, wildfire science, or fire ecology.
  • -Experience in one or more of the following areas: wildland fuels mapping, wildfire response field support, land use/land cover change detection, LiDAR.
  • -Proven experience with Python and/or R.
  • -Working knowledge of Google Earth Engine.
  • -Working knowledge of Power Automate and Power BI.
  • -Experience with machine learning and advanced statistical techniques.
